R-1
Low Density Residential District
These districts are designed to provide suitable areas for low density residential development characterized by an open appearance. The residential development will consist of single family detached dwellings and accessory structures. These districts also include community facilities, public utilities and open uses which serve specifically the residents of these districts. Further, it is the intent of this chapter that these districts be located so that the provision of appropriate urban services will be physically and economically feasible and so that provision is made for the orderly expansion and maintenance of urban residential development.
